This refer to distance travelled by sound trough time. The warmer air the faster the travel while colder air, the slower the travel.
a.sound has longitudinal waves
b. sound has speed
c. sound has loudness

Heat, like sound, is a form of kinetic energy. Molecules at higher temperatures have more energy and can vibrate faster and allow sound waves to travel more quickly.
